声纳抱怨扫描仪应始终关闭,对吗?
Scanner scanner = new Scanner("simple string")
该扫描仪未从文件等进行扫描.为什么应将其关闭?@H_404_10@
最佳答案@H_404_10@
通过调用新的Scanner(“ string”),它会创建一个
StringReader
来创建一个字符流.因此,您必须关闭它.
public Scanner(String source) {
this(new StringReader(source),WHITESPACE_PATTERN);
}
@H_404_10@
原文链接:https://www.f2er.com/java/532900.html